Objective:To test the validity and reliability of the University of California at Los Angeles Posttraumatic Stress Disorder Reaction Index for DSM-Ⅳ (Revision 1,Children version) (UCLA PTSD-RI) in Chinese Children after flood.Methods:On the principle of convenient sampling,the students were chosen from 6 schools in Liaoning Province where was hit by flood.Totally 1593 students [aged 8-16 years,average (11 ± 2) years of age]completed the UCLA PTSD-RI.They were randomly divided into two groups for exploratory factor analysis (n =796) and confirmatory factor analysis (n =797) respectively.The 21-item Depression Anxiety Stress Scale(DASS-21) were used to evaluate the criterion validity.Results:The result of exploratory factor analysis indicated UCLA PTSD-RI consisted of 3 factors,accounting for 50% of the total variance.The confirmatory factor analysis identified that a three-factor model fit well (x2/df=3.87,GFI =0.93,RFI =0.96,CFI =097,NNFI =0.97,IFI =0.97,RM-SEA =0.06).The scores of UCLA PTSD-RI subscales were positively correlated with the scores of DASS-21 subscales (r =0.52-0.70,Ps < 0.001).The Cronbach's a coefficient and the split-half reliability coefficient of UCLA PTSD-RI were 0.90 and 0.87,respectively.Conclusion:The Chinese Version of the UCLA PTSD Reaction Index for DSM-Ⅳ (Revision 1,Children version) could be an effective instrument for assessing and diagnosing PTSD of Chinese children after disasters.

This study was undertaken to investigate the cytotoxicity of orthodontic wires after doing various treatments to the wires. 018x025 inch Stainless steel(A) and Co-Cr(B) wires were used and each of them were divided into 4 groups. A-1 and B-1 groups were as received state, and A-2 and B-2 groups were heat treated. A-3 and B-3 groups were electropolished after heat treatment, and A-4 and B-4 groups were soldered with Ag-solder. Each group had 3 wires and these were sterilized with Ethylene Oxide gas. We used human gingival fibroblast cell culture and agar overlay technique to investigate the cytotoxicity of each group of wires. The cytotoxicity of wire was assessed using reaction index (zone index / lysis index). The findings of this study were as follows: 1. Both of the stainless steel wire and Co-Cr wire showed no cytotoxicity in as received state. 2. Heat treatment or electropolishing of the wires had no effect on the cytotoxicity of the wires. 3. Soldered stainless steel wires showed a little wider zone of discoloration than soldered Co-Cr wires, but the zone index and cytotoxicitytreaction index) was not different. 4. Soldered wires showed moderate cytotoxicity in both of the wires.
